It also owns numerous Moray sites, including Cardhu and Cragganmore, among others.<\/p>\n<p>Dalwhinnie &#8211; the only local distillery operated by the drinks giant &#8211; is understood not to be involved in this current round of redundancies.<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.gmb.org.uk\/gmb-regions\/gmb-scotland\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">GMB Scotland<\/a> has launched an attack on the company&#8217;s handling of the consultation process, claiming executives have refused to discuss measures that could reduce the number of compulsory redundancies.<\/p>\n<p>The union says a four-week consultation ended last week without any agreement being reached and has described the process as little more than a &#8220;box-ticking exercise&#8221;.<\/p>\n<p>Lesley-Anne Macaskill, GMB Scotland organiser for the Highlands and Islands, said workers&#8217; concerns had been ignored throughout discussions.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;We have now had five meetings with the company to discuss its plans but there has been no serious attempt to engage with our members&#8217; concerns or modify its plans in any way,&#8221; she said.<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"rthmb\" src=\"data:image\/svg+xml,%3Csvg xmlns=\" http:=\"\" viewbox=\"0 0 1200 1313\" alt=\"Lesley-Anne MacAskill, GMB organiser.\" data-root=\"\/_media\/img\/\" data-path=\"93WKPL7UN6SIZNUJXFHN.jpg\" data-ar=\"0.91\"\/><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/britain\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/08\/93WKPL7UN6SIZNUJXFHN.jpg\" alt=\"Lesley-Anne MacAskill, GMB organiser.\"\/>Lesley-Anne MacAskill, GMB organiser.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;This has not been a genuine consultation but a box-ticking exercise by a company intent on steam-rollering through job losses to a plan that has already been decided.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;The absolute refusal to engage with our members&#8217; concerns is a morally bankrupt betrayal of a skilled, experienced and committed workforce.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>The union says it repeatedly proposed alternatives including voluntary redundancy schemes and job-sharing arrangements, arguing these approaches are commonly used across the industry to minimise compulsory job losses.<\/p>\n<p>However, it claims every proposal was rejected.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;Our members understand the company must respond to changing demand but that can be done with respect, fairness and genuine consultation,&#8221; Ms Macaskill added.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;Instead, it has refused to listen or alter its plans in any way.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>GMB has also criticised Diageo&#8217;s decision not to provide details of potential redundancy payments before workers enter an individual assessment and scoring process.<\/p>\n<p>According to the union, employees at risk will now be graded before attending one-to-one meetings, with redundancy terms still unclear.<\/p>\n<p>Ms Macaskill said it had become apparent during negotiations that company representatives &#8220;had no authority&#8221; to amend the proposals, labelling the consultation a \u201csham\u201d.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;It became obvious the decisions have already been taken elsewhere, miles away from the rural communities where the impact of these redundancies will be felt,&#8221; she said.<\/p>\n<p>The union has now formally rejected the consultation process and plans to write to politicians across the Highlands and Islands urging them to intervene, warning the losses could have consequences far beyond the distillery gates.<\/p>\n<p>The cuts form part of a worldwide restructuring programme being led by Diageo chief executive Sir Dave Lewis.<\/p>\n<p>Reports have suggested as many as a third of the company&#8217;s global workforce of around 30,000 could ultimately be affected as the company seeks to reduce costs and respond to changing market conditions.<\/p>\n<p>Consultation is also continuing at Diageo&#8217;s production, bottling and distribution sites elsewhere in Scotland.<\/p>\n<p>Diageo has previously said it needs to reshape parts of its business to reflect changing demand and improve efficiency, although GMB insists the company has failed to explore every possible option to protect jobs.<\/p>\n<p>    Do you want to respond to this article?
